David Herbert Posted March 13, 2013 Share Posted March 13, 2013 " I put some heavy gear oil in" Please don't say that you used an EP grade oil. It will attack the bronze very quickly and the surface will break up within weeks. David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Tony B Posted March 14, 2013 Share Posted March 14, 2013 You can get straight 90 oil. Morris lubricants do it. Safe for bronze bits.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
